我在他们的网站上阅读Angular:https://angular.io/features.html,我看到以下内容:
跨平台
渐进式网络应用 - 使用现代网络平台功能提供类似应用的体验。 高性能,离线和零步安装。
Native - 使用Ionic Framework的策略构建原生移动应用程序, NativeScript和React Native。
桌面 - 使用Microsoft在Mac,Windows和Linux上创建桌面安装的应用程序 你为网络学到的相同的角度方法加上能力 访问本机OS API。
当Angular说你可以“在Mac,Windows和Linux上创建桌面安装的应用程序”时,该页面的哪一部分正在讨论? Angular是否具有生成桌面应用程序的内置功能?或者他们是在谈论使用某些第三方框架,例如电子?
答案 0 :(得分:0)
有一些方法可以在JavaScript中为您的应用编写UI。至少它可用于Win8 / Win8.1 WindowsStore应用程序(不确定其他平台,但我很确定有办法做到这一点)。例如。你可以在你的应用程序中包含任何JS库。我可能是错的,但根据我的理解,当您启动该应用程序时,它是从特殊类型的InternetExplorer进程运行的。有很多类似的应用程序。例如,一些Skype也使用IE(例如显示广告)。作为基本示例,请参阅http://onehungrymind.com/windows-8-and-angularjs/
Google for WinJS